Permalink
Browse files

20081012 1.6.4-beta1 ratler

    * Beta 1 release!

    * Modules
    - Kernel bumped to 2.6.27
    - All packages refreshed
    - freetype2 removed

    * Installer
    - Fixed issue with swap partitions showing up twice in fstab
      if you add more than one
    - Fixed issue with block device list, Bash 3.2 changed behavior 
      in =~ operator, the regex can no longer be quoted
    - Modified a small problem in transfer() where some variables got
      assigned with the wrong values. Also added a feature to list
      what filesystem type you choosed for the assigned partition
    - Disabled the dialog that tell the user to rebuild the kernel for
      xfs, jfs and reiserfs since the kernel now includes them by default
    - More software raid fixes from ElAngelo
    - We now disable /tmp on tmpfs if the user add a /tmp partition
    - Precompiled kernels will now get registered as installed
    - Simplified the language menu. This time the iso process will
      create a file on the iso that contain a language list
    - perl moved from extended.list -> base.list, needed for vim to work
      on the iso
    - As mentioned the default kernel config now compile xfs, jfs and reiserfs
      as builtin

    * Script changes
    - isofs
      - Disable memtest on x86_64 (doesn't build or work anyway)
      - New isolinux templates for x86_64, needed since memtest is gone
    - rebuild
      - Make sure we copy the kernel config for the correct arch to the ISO
    - initrd
      - Fixed lib64 symlink issue, could cause issues with the running system
    - memtest
      - exit 0 if x86_64
    - gen_locale_list
      - New script to generate a language list from the locale-archive in $ISO_TARGET
  • Loading branch information...
1 parent 5545764 commit cf826c80fd14a16aa20ab32b393c2f9df0cee12e @Ratler Ratler committed Oct 12, 2008
View
@@ -27,11 +27,16 @@ export ISO_SOURCE ISO_TARGET ISO_MAJOR ISO_MINOR ISO_VERSION ISO_CODENAME \
all: iso
-iso: initrd proper $(ISO_TARGET)/.iso
+iso: initrd proper locale $(ISO_TARGET)/.iso
$(ISO_TARGET)/.iso:
@echo "Generating ISO"
@scripts/isofs
+locale: $(ISO_TARGET)/.locale_list
+$(ISO_TARGET)/.locale_list:
+ @echo "Generating locale list"
+ @scripts/gen_locale_list
+
proper: aaa_dev aaa_base $(ISO_TARGET)/.proper
$(ISO_TARGET)/.proper:
@echo "Cleaning BUILD"
@@ -123,6 +128,7 @@ clean:
rm -f template/moonbase.tar.bz2
rm -f kernels/linux kernels/linux.map
rm -f kernels/safe kernels/safe.map
+ rm -rf locale
dist: lunar-$(ISO_VERSION).iso
rm -f lunar-$(ISO_VERSION).iso.{bz2,md5,bz2.md5}
View
42 NEWS
@@ -1,3 +1,45 @@
+20081012 1.6.4-beta1 ratler
+ * Beta 1 release!
+
+ * Modules
+ - Kernel bumped to 2.6.27
+ - All packages refreshed
+ - freetype2 removed
+
+ * Installer
+ - Fixed issue with swap partitions showing up twice in fstab
+ if you add more than one
+ - Fixed issue with block device list, Bash 3.2 changed behavior
+ in =~ operator, the regex can no longer be quoted
+ - Modified a small problem in transfer() where some variables got
+ assigned with the wrong values. Also added a feature to list
+ what filesystem type you choosed for the assigned partition
+ - Disabled the dialog that tell the user to rebuild the kernel for
+ xfs, jfs and reiserfs since the kernel now includes them by default
+ - More software raid fixes from ElAngelo
+ - We now disable /tmp on tmpfs if the user add a /tmp partition
+ - Precompiled kernels will now get registered as installed
+ - Simplified the language menu. This time the iso process will
+ create a file on the iso that contain a language list
+ - perl moved from extended.list -> base.list, needed for vim to work
+ on the iso
+ - As mentioned the default kernel config now compile xfs, jfs and reiserfs
+ as builtin
+
+ * Script changes
+ - isofs
+ - Disable memtest on x86_64 (doesn't build or work anyway)
+ - New isolinux templates for x86_64, needed since memtest is gone
+ - rebuild
+ - Make sure we copy the kernel config for the correct arch to the ISO
+ - initrd
+ - Fixed lib64 symlink issue, could cause issues with the running system
+ - memtest
+ - exit 0 if x86_64
+ - gen_locale_list
+ - New script to generate a language list from the locale-archive in $ISO_TARGET
+
+
20080914 1.6.4-alpha3 ratler
* Alpha release 3
View
1 TODO
@@ -1,5 +1,4 @@
* man lfirsttime bugs?
* make lilo/grub bootloaders optionally show up instead of always.
* make lnet put own hostname in /etc/hosts !
-* make iso always install linux-2.6 for automatic kernel updates
* add microcode update tools
View
@@ -38,7 +38,6 @@ less
cpio
file
tar
-grub
lilo
man
parted
@@ -65,3 +64,4 @@ acl
attr
vim
mdadm
+perl
View
@@ -5,7 +5,7 @@
# copy this file to 'config' and edit your settings as needed
-# Which arch are we compiling for? Hint: i868 or x86-64
+# Which arch are we compiling for? Hint: i868 or x86_64
ISO_ARCH = i686
View
@@ -1,8 +1,6 @@
-perl
m4
autoconf
gettext
-freetype2
chkconfig
bison
yawl
View
@@ -2,4 +2,3 @@ linux-2.6
ndiswrapper
iwlwifi-3945-ucode
iwlwifi-4965-ucode
-mc
View
@@ -0,0 +1,22 @@
+
+Lunar-%VERSION%.iso, 0c%CODENAME% (%DATE%)07, kernel %KERNEL%
+
+0eWelcome07 to 05Lunar Linux07 Copyright (C) %COPYRIGHTYEAR% by the
+09Lunar-Linux team <maintainer@lunar-linux.org>07
+All Rights Reserved.
+
+Lunar Linux is distributed under the terms of the GNU GPLv2. Please see
+0dhttp://www.gnu.org/copyleft/gpl.html07 for the GNU GPL.
+
+Download Lunar Linux and docs from 0dhttp://lunar-linux.org/07
+
+To continue press ENTER, or use the function keys to select other pages.
+
+F1 - this page
+F2 - booting when you need special drivers loaded
+F3 - safe mode booting
+
+
+To continue, press 02ENTER07
+
+ 02F102 install 0aF207 modules 0aF307 safe
View
@@ -0,0 +1,23 @@
+
+Lunar-%VERSION%.iso, 0c%CODENAME% (%DATE%)07, kernel %KERNEL%
+
+0eWelcome07 to 05Lunar Linux07 Copyright (C) %COPYRIGHTYEAR% by the
+09Lunar-Linux team <maintainer@lunar-linux.org>07
+All Rights Reserved.
+
+Loading additional drivers
+
+When you need special drivers to install on special IDE hardware or SCSI
+cards, or other input devices such as USB, you will need to load certain
+kernel modules before installing.
+
+To load these modules, type 02linux07 and load the modules from the initrd
+menu. If you know the name of the module you can also append the name of the
+module to the boot prompt: 02linux aacraid uhci-hcd ehci-hcd07.
+
+The installer will attempt to load some modules automatically.
+
+
+type 02linux07 followed by optional kernel parameters to use this boot option
+
+ 0aF107 install 02F202 modules 0aF307 safe
View
@@ -0,0 +1,23 @@
+
+Lunar-%VERSION%.iso, 0c%CODENAME% (%DATE%)07, kernel %KERNEL%
+
+0eWelcome07 to 05Lunar Linux07 Copyright (C) %COPYRIGHTYEAR% by the
+09Lunar-Linux team <maintainer@lunar-linux.org>07
+All Rights Reserved.
+
+Safe mode
+
+In order to boot with certain hardware and kernel features disabled,
+type 02safe07 to the boot prompt and press ENTER. This option
+also disables MTRR, RAID, LVM, USB keyboard, FireWire and much more such
+as APM, ACPI, APIC etc. Some hardware may not function as well.
+
+This safe mode does not restrict your access to write to devices, so
+beware when you need to recover a broken system. If you wish to perform
+recovery of a broken system, boot into the installer and use the 03shell07
+option to start a rescue shell
+
+
+type 02safe07 followed by optional kernel parameters to use this boot option
+
+ 0aF107 install 0aF207 modules 02F302 safe
@@ -0,0 +1,25 @@
+DEFAULT install
+APPEND read-only load_ramdisk=1 ramdisk_size=INITRDSIZE initrd=initrd root=/dev/ram0 prompt_ramdisk=0 rootdelay=10
+DISPLAY f1.txt
+TIMEOUT 600
+PROMPT 1
+F1 f1.txt
+F2 f2.txt
+F3 f3.txt
+F4 f1.txt
+F5 f1.txt
+F6 f1.txt
+F7 f1.txt
+F8 f1.txt
+F9 f1.txt
+LABEL install
+ KERNEL linux
+ APPEND read-only load_ramdisk=1 ramdisk_size=INITRDSIZE initrd=initrd root=/dev/ram0 prompt_ramdisk=0 vga=ask rootdelay=10 skipinitrd
+LABEL linux
+ KERNEL linux
+ APPEND read-only load_ramdisk=1 ramdisk_size=INITRDSIZE initrd=initrd root=/dev/ram0 prompt_ramdisk=0 vga=ask
+LABEL safe
+ KERNEL safe
+ APPEND read-only load_ramdisk=1 ramdisk_size=INITRDSIZE initrd=initrd root=/dev/ram0 prompt_ramdisk=0 vga=normal acpi=off apm=off noapic noisapnp nosmp notsc
+# uncomment the following line to enable serial console booting
+# SERIAL 0 38400
Oops, something went wrong.

0 comments on commit cf826c8

Please sign in to comment.